def lmio_api(dev=False, username=None, password=None): r""" Generate a Flask App that will serve meshes landmarks and templates to landmarker.io Parameters ---------- adapter: :class:`LandmarkerIOAdapter` Concrete implementation of the LandmarkerIOAdapter. Will be queried for all data to pass to landmarker.io. dev: `bool`, optional If True, listen to anyone for CORS. username : str, optional If provided basic auth will be applied for this username. Requires password to also be provided. password : str, optional If provided basic auth will be applied for this password. Requires username to also be provided. Returns ------- api, app, api_endpoint """ app = Flask(__name__) # create the flask app # 1. configure CORS decorator cors_dict = { 'origin': Server.origin, 'headers': ['Origin', 'X-Requested-With', 'Content-Type', 'Accept'], 'methods': ['HEAD', 'GET', 'POST', 'PATCH', 'PUT', 'OPTIONS', 'DELETE'], 'credentials': True } if dev: # in development mode, accept CORS from anyone (but we can't use HTTPS) cors_dict['origin'] = '*' cors_dict['credentials'] = False app.debug = True # create the cors decorator decorators = [cors.crossdomain(**cors_dict)] if username is not None and password is not None: print('enabling basic auth') # note the we cors is the last decorator -> the first that is hit. This # is what we want as CORS will detect OPTIONS requests and allow them # immediately. All other requests will be sent through the basicauth # decorator. decorators.insert(0, basicauth(username, password)) api = Api(app, decorators=decorators) return api, app
